**Q: A deep link opens the Pinwheel app but lands on the home screen instead of the target view — what gives?**

Nine times out of ten the route registry cache on the device is stale after a release. Ask the user to force-close and reopen; if it persists, check the routing service's mapping table. The full troubleshooting flow is on our internal page.

runbook for badug-kadup: https://confluence.zemvarlabs.internal/projects/browse/display/projects/bd1b

Heads up for plugin authors: the Quillbase 4.2 planner regression made nested-loop joins win over hash joins on mid-size tables, so plugins that pushed down filters got slow plans. We've patched the cost model, but if your plugin supplies row estimates, please re-test against the new weights. For reference, here are the cost constants the planner now uses:

tuning table, yajog-yahof:
BUDGETS = {
    "lamvan": 303,
    "wenox": 460,
    "fenvan": 525,
}

TICKET SHARD-187 — Drift detected in Profilecrest shard map settings

On-call: the user-profile store's shard rebalancer is running with values that no longer match the committed baseline. It appears a live tuning session two weeks ago adjusted shard counts and hash ring weights without updating source control. Until reconciliation completes, do not trigger a manual rebalance, as the drifted values could double-move hot partitions. For reference during your shift, the configuration actually running on the primary coordinator is listed below.

settings of tagef-bawif:
DRUIX_HOST=druix.zemvarlabs.internal
DRUIX_PORT=8000

# Break-Glass: Catalog Cache Invalidation

Scope: the Pinrow product catalog at Veldstone Retail. If stale prices persist after a purge and the Hollowmere invalidation queue is wedged, use break-glass to flush the edge tier directly. Contractors: get verbal sign-off from the catalog lead first. Steps: open the Hollowmere admin shell, select emergency-flush, confirm the tenant, and run it once — repeated flushes thrash the origin. Access is logged and expires after 20 minutes. Unseal the admin shell with the passphrase below.

recovery phrase for kahop-tajog: istix-casvan